...the recovered data included user SMS and voice call contents, user internet traffic, and cellular network signaling protocols... the team was able to collect unencrypted satellite data “from sea vessels owned by the US military,” along with traffic from multiple organizations within the Mexican government and military, including personnel records, narcotics activity, and military asset tracking...

Steadily improving. I set up my webserver with ech which is the next step, hiding even the domain. A solid chunk of the internet uses cloudflare as an intermediary, which also has ech and only leaves "someone connected to some cloudflare page at this time for that amount of data".

As more places roll out deep package inspection, I'm sure in due time more randomization for package sizes will follow, making even the amount of data uncertain.

Most web metadata is at the http layer anyway and has always been hidden by https.
